An intelligent Community adhering to what is actually Worked Since 1997

Slashdot is made by Rob “CmdrTaco” Malda in 1997. This snarky taco lover wished to feature development stories about technological developments, computers, space, and even politics. Essentially, this site publishes stuff that does matter to tech experts by relying on individual tips.

From beginning, the website’s tone ended up being tongue-in-cheek. Based on the web site, “‘Slashdot is an intentionally obnoxious URL. Whenever Rob licensed the domain name http://slashdot.org, he wanted a URL that was confusing when read aloud.”

Within its first 12 months, the personal development website was seeing a lot more than 100,000 pageviews a-day and attracted a faithful system of tech geeks. Throughout the years, the website advanced in many ways many longtime consumers, the whom was indeed around since 1997, don’t value.

In 2016, BizX obtained Slashdot and started taking the site back to the roots. The technology business wants to carry on marketing well-respected content and facilitating significant conversations because that’s how Slashdot turned into very winning to start with.

“We brought Slashdot back to the basic principles of user-generated stories,” Logan demonstrated. “the website seems very much the same because performed for the ‘90s. Our modifications are typically getting reduce those things our very own people failed to like.” Like, in a poll, 97% of users voted to get rid of movies on Slashdot, therefore the website discontinued all movie content material.

“we have truly produced an attempt to tune in to our very own customers a lot more,” Logan mentioned. “There is a very good, committed base, and then we’re maybe not wanting to reinvent the wheel right here. We need to remain correct to what Slashdot is and it has long been.”

Breaking the Mold With User-Generated information & Technical News

Slashdot utilizes the quality of its content material to generate interest and spark conversation. “We steer clear of clickbait,” Logan told all of us. “It is all user-submitted content.”

Everyone can submit a story to Slashdot. Editors work from another location across the world and supervise the feed anyway several hours. From a great deal of articles, the editors curate by far the most salient, considerate, and compelling stories to write on main web page. Every single day, this site articles about 35 stories that highlight splitting tech development and the opinions of real readers. These article pieces provoke conversation among an internet community of individuals who do work in highly technical tasks.

“Our website isn’t really for tech enthusiasts,” Logan emphasized to all of us. “We’re a hardcore tech web site for those who work in technology. It’s probably one of the more technical communities you will find online.”

On Slashdot, the main subjects start around devices to YRO (your liberties online). You can easily scan by subject to acquire a prominent story that interests you. For the Firehose part, you’ll see an unfiltered feed of post submissions published by consumers and voted up or down by users. A colored symbol suggests exactly how popular the distribution is — red is a hot tale and bluish is actually cold.

Meta-Moderation & Upvoted feedback Help debate Flow

Twenty many years after it actually was established, Slashdot still maintains an active community of technical positives on line. The website averages over 4,000 opinions each day on their stories.

Customers share their unique knowledge on particular subject areas and supply in-depth evaluation towards development throughout the day. Occasionally passionate and knowledgeable customers will publish reviews that are running over 1,000 words very long. “Some feedback could standalone as articles by themselves,” mentioned Logan.

Obviously, the greater number of debatable subjects find out more responses as folks linger over talks about legal rights to privacy on the web or political advancements impacting the technology industry. The message board is prepared for individuals of all opinions, but consumers please call one another down.

Because the discussion board centers around hot-button issues, you would consider the conversation would get conveniently derailed or toned down from the cheapest common denominator online, but Slashdot devised an ingenious voting program keeping the trolls from overtaking the statements section.

“exactly what stands apart about all of our website is all of our comment program,” Logan told us. “its distinctive because of the way we let people moderate one another.”

On Slashdot, consumers vote on feedback (ranging from -1 to +5) to point the grade of the person’s feedback. An average rating is actually conspicuously demonstrated near the top of the comment. Tired of reading inane reviews? It is possible to filter them completely by using the scale on the right-hand section of the web page, so you merely see opinions with at least rating that you set yourself.

Additionally, people can pick labels like informative, redundant, off-topic, helpful, amusing, as well as other modifiers to either compliments or flag a specific remark. Effective customers earn mod points so they can moderate feedback. They will be scored by users on how really they performed. Slashdot’s meta-moderation system guarantees consumers are constantly keeping each other accountable while using the internet.

“consequently, we come across well thought-out and very long remarks,” Logan revealed. “it will help the comments and conversation stream much more normally if you have the people moderating the website and something another.”
